This lightweight cardigan tutorial was made using double stranded#0 yarn, but it's equal to a #1 fingering weight. It makes for a fantastic lightweight cardigan for summer.

Notes:
This cardigan is worked flat in 2 separate pieces and then sewn together (2 panels are made the same)
In this tutorial I have demonstrated with size small

Yarn needed for size small = 2,600 yards of #0 lace weight. If you're using #1 fingering weight, cut the yardage in half plus a little extra (just to be safe)

Gauge blocked: 23 st X 10 rows = 4" In main stitch pattern, row 12 and 13 is a main stitch pattern repeat. To make a gauge swash, ch an even number and then crochet row 1-23

Measurements for size small = 25.60" Body width across X 25.73" Length
